Balogun market traders protest against their colleague over yearly fire incident

Two days after fire took over a plaza in Balogun market, Lagos, hundreds of traders have staged a protest against their colleague, whose shop the fire started from.
The plaza had gone up in flames on Sunday morning, October 9, after it broke out from a fabric shop, owned by a woman.
Staging a protest on Tuesday, October 11, the traders claimed the fire incident happens every year and it always starts from the woman’s shop.
